การอ้างอิงถึงแอป Firebase Android
อย่าเรียกตัวสร้างนี้โดยตรง ให้ใช้ ProjectManagement.androidApp() แทน .
ลายเซ็น:
export declare class AndroidApp
คุณสมบัติ
คุณสมบัติ | ตัวดัดแปลง | พิมพ์ | คำอธิบาย |
---|---|---|---|
รหัสแอป | เชือก |
วิธีการ
วิธี | ตัวดัดแปลง | คำอธิบาย |
---|---|---|
addShaCertificate (ใบรับรองการเพิ่ม) | เพิ่มใบรับรอง SHA ที่กำหนดให้กับแอป Android นี้ | |
ลบ ShaCertificate (certificateToDelete) | ลบใบรับรอง SHA ที่ระบุออกจากแอป Android นี้ | |
รับการกำหนดค่า() | รับส่วนการกำหนดค่าที่เกี่ยวข้องกับแอปนี้ | |
รับข้อมูลเมตา() | ดึงข้อมูลเมตาเกี่ยวกับแอป Android นี้ | |
getShaCertificates () | รับรายการใบรับรอง SHA ที่เชื่อมโยงกับแอป Android นี้ใน Firebase | |
setDisplayName(ชื่อดิสเพลย์ใหม่) | ตั้งค่าชื่อที่แสดงที่ผู้ใช้กำหนดของแอป (ไม่บังคับ) |
AndroidApp.appId
ลายเซ็น:
readonly appId: string;
AndroidApp.addShaCertificate()
เพิ่มใบรับรอง SHA ที่กำหนดให้กับแอป Android นี้
ลายเซ็น:
addShaCertificate(certificateToAdd: ShaCertificate): Promise<void>;
พารามิเตอร์
พารามิเตอร์ | พิมพ์ | คำอธิบาย |
---|---|---|
ใบรับรองเพื่อเพิ่ม | ใบรับรอง ShaCertificate | ใบรับรอง SHA ที่จะเพิ่ม |
ผลตอบแทน:
สัญญา<โมฆะ>
คำสัญญาที่ได้รับการแก้ไขเมื่อมีการเพิ่มใบรับรองที่กำหนดลงในแอป Android
AndroidApp.deleteShaCertificate()
ลบใบรับรอง SHA ที่ระบุออกจากแอป Android นี้
ลายเซ็น:
deleteShaCertificate(certificateToDelete: ShaCertificate): Promise<void>;
พารามิเตอร์
พารามิเตอร์ | พิมพ์ | คำอธิบาย |
---|---|---|
ใบรับรองToDelete | ใบรับรอง ShaCertificate | ใบรับรอง SHA ที่จะลบ |
ผลตอบแทน:
สัญญา<โมฆะ>
คำสัญญาที่จะแก้ไขเมื่อใบรับรองที่ระบุถูกลบออกจากแอป Android
AndroidApp.getConfig()
รับส่วนการกำหนดค่าที่เกี่ยวข้องกับแอปนี้
ลายเซ็น:
getConfig(): Promise<string>;
ผลตอบแทน:
สัญญา<สตริง>
คำสัญญาที่แก้ไขเป็นไฟล์กำหนดค่า Firebase ของแอป Android ในรูปแบบสตริง UTF-8 โดยทั่วไปสตริงนี้มีวัตถุประสงค์เพื่อเขียนลงในไฟล์ JSON ที่มาพร้อมกับแอป Android ของคุณ
AndroidApp.getMetadata()
ดึงข้อมูลเมตาเกี่ยวกับแอป Android นี้
ลายเซ็น:
getMetadata(): Promise<AndroidAppMetadata>;
ผลตอบแทน:
สัญญา < AndroidAppMetadata >
คำมั่นสัญญาที่จะแก้ไขข้อมูลเมตาที่ดึงมาเกี่ยวกับแอป Android นี้
AndroidApp.getShaCertificates()
รับรายการใบรับรอง SHA ที่เชื่อมโยงกับแอป Android นี้ใน Firebase
ลายเซ็น:
getShaCertificates(): Promise<ShaCertificate[]>;
ผลตอบแทน:
สัญญา< ShaCertificate []>
รายการใบรับรอง SHA-1 และ SHA-256 ที่เชื่อมโยงกับแอป Android นี้ใน Firebase
AndroidApp.setDisplayName()
ตั้งค่าชื่อที่แสดงที่ผู้ใช้กำหนดของแอป (ไม่บังคับ)
ลายเซ็น:
setDisplayName(newDisplayName: string): Promise<void>;
พารามิเตอร์
พารามิเตอร์ | พิมพ์ | คำอธิบาย |
---|---|---|
ใหม่ชื่อที่แสดง | เชือก | ชื่อที่แสดงใหม่ที่จะตั้งค่า |
ผลตอบแทน:
สัญญา<โมฆะ>
คำสัญญาที่จะแก้ไขเมื่อมีการตั้งชื่อที่แสดง